Join Host Evangelist Wayne and Featured Guest "Kilroy Roybal"

At 13 years old, he began a journey to being “State Raised” and a very long association with the California gang subculture. His decisions lead him into a revolving door to state corrections and, inevitably, a 40-year prison experience. Roy eventually arrived at San Quentin State Prison at the ripe old age of 19 years old. In San Quentin, Roy became a member of the Mexican Mafia prison gang and became deeply entrenched in the prison gang mentality. This eventually translated into his becoming a loyal and uncompromising gang edict enforcer, leader, and "shot caller."

However, God had a plan, and forty plus years of hard living, crime, gang life, and prison life was not the plan God had for finally defining who Ernest "Kilroy" Roybal was to ultimately be, or what he was to represent.
